I recently got a pair of Predator Absolado LZ TRX FG. I just needed something not too expensive and these were the cheapest the store had in stock in my size. I had to get it in the Infrared/White color scheme because they were out of the others. I normally wear a US 8 1/2, but have a wide foot so I got them in 9. The side was a little tight at first but by the end of the first game had stretched out enough that it didn't bother me. The toebox had enough room yet didn't seem too big like some size 9s do. I can't really comment on how they hold up yet, but I figured someone might be interested in the fit.
